Postingan

M8 - Pemrograman Berorientasi Object

1.  Method  dengan bertipe mengembalikan nilai akan menggunakan kata kunci   void. Pilih salah satu: Benar Salah   alasan : 1.       Method  tidak mengembalikan nilai Kata kunci void memungkinkan kita membuat method yang tidak mengembalikan nilai. Contoh: void nama_metode ( ) {        System. out .println(“Belajar Java”); } 2. Method  mengembalikan nilai Jenis kedua adalah jika method diberi awalan sebuah tipe data maka method tersebut akan memberi nilai balik data yang bertipe data sama dengan method tersebut. Penggunaan perintah “return” dapat digunakan untuk mengevaluasi ekspresi, kemudian mengirim nilai yang dihasilkan ke pemanggilan method.   int jumlah () {     hasil = nilai1 + nilai2;     return hasil; // mengembalikan suatu nilai dari metode } 2.  Kata kunci   this   digunakan untuk... Pilih salah satu: Membedakan variabel  ins...

M7 - Pemrograman Berorientasi Object

1.  Non Static Nested Class  tidak memiliki akses ke variabel instance dan method pada  outer class . Pilih salah satu: Benar Salah   alasan :  Static Nested Class  tidak memiliki akses ke variabel instance dan method pada outer class. 2.  Perhatikan sintaks berikut. public class Lingkaran { public static void main ( String []args ) { final double PI = 3.14159265358979323846 ; double r = 5.5 ; double luas; luas = PI* r * r; System. out .println( "Luas lingkaran adalah " + luas); } } Output program di atas adalah... Pilih salah satu: Luas lingkaran adalah 95.03317777109123   Luas lingkaran adalah 95 Syntax error 95.03317777109123 alasan : Class  merupakan sarana untuk mengumpulkan fungsi dan variabel dalam satu tempat dan dapat saling berinteraksi sehingga membentuk sebuah program. Sintaks pembuatan class pada Java : class NamaClass {     String atribut1;     Str...